About this apartment rental

The Purple Sage Park Place Apartment is spacious, charming and inviting. This little gem in downtown Winthrop provides a fun and convenient lodging experience on the back (river)side of town. Features 700 square feet of living space, private deck...lovely

Spacious and inviting, this little gem in downtown Winthrop provides a fun and convenient lodging experience, with charming ambiance and creature comforts.

Enjoy easy access to Winthrop's shops and restaurants from this unique, riverside 1-bedroom apartment, overlooking the confluence of the Chewuch and Methow Rivers. Relax in the cozy and fully furnished living room, prepare meals in the fully-equipped kitchen, or sit back on the deck and enjoy a cup of fresh local coffee. All the details are taken care of.

The bedroom has 1 King bed. An A/C wall unit is available for the hotter season.

Easy off-street parking is provided.

EXTREMELY IMPORTANT YEAR ROUND TRAVEL INFORMATION--READ BEFORE BOOKING A RESERVATION:
1)It is the responsibility of the guest , who is traveling from the west side of the state, to have travel plans in place to travel either over the North Cascades via Highway 20 OR to travel over Steven's Pass through Leavenworth OR to travel I-90 over Snoqualmie to Blewett Pass through Wenatchee and then up the Columbia river to the Methow Valley. If one route is closed, it is the YOUR responsibility to make alternate plans for travel. NO REFUNDS will be given at any time of the year simply because an alternate route must be taken and add additional travel time. Highway 20 is closed in the winter and mountain passes can be closed anytime of the year because of wildfires, rockslides or other occurrences. Directions over all the routes will be sent to. you 3 days before your arrival. Make sure to check pass reports(and they can change while you are en route) and print out the directions before you leave.

IMPORTANT WINTER INFORMATION POLICY :
**Should you travel to the Methow during the winter months it is important to understand that you must be prepared for winter driving(keep chains, shovel...in the car) and all the inconveniences it causes you and the community you are visiting. The weather can be extreme with large snowfalls, unexpected technical issues, frozen pipes, impassable roads/driveways). If it snows while here you will have to wait for plow service just like every other person in the valley. There are a limited number of plow companies and Methow Reservations nor the owners of the house are in control of the plow company schedules. They have many different contracts and many miles of roads, driveways...to plow. If a plow person or a snow shoveler shows up to clear any area around the house, please do not argue with them or turn them away. Move your vehicles if asked. Your cooperation and patience are required especially after any significant snow accumulation. Should you get stuck you can call Classic Towing in Twisp, WA

**WEATHER CONDITIONS**

We cannot be responsible for winter weather conditions. If you will be arriving during the winter, please be sure you have proper equipment for driving in the snow, and carry tire chains for driving over the passes. Our local roads are always kept open and in good condition for winter travel. There are no refunds for road closures; however, if both Stevens and Snoqualmie mountain passes are closed for more than eight hours and the closures prohibit you from reaching the property, you may reschedule your stay for an arrival within three months of the pass closures. Please note that the North Cascades Pass is always closed during winter.

We recommend you check weather conditions before driving through the passes during the winter at the DOT's website
